    Some people are harder on the machinery than others. In the days of Hewland gearboxes it was said that one World Champion would regularly finish a race with ruined dog-rings but as long as the car finished nothing would be said about it. If the car didn't finish then plenty would be said. Another example, Graham Hill -- tyres last one race, Jim Clark on the same tyres they last four races.

    Fernando Alonso (DNF, Engine): "My start was brilliant. The car did an amazing launch and I managed to gain several positions, up to third place, but after that we were in the wrong place at the wrong time. I wasn't aware of what was happening on the inside, all I know is that at Turn One some cars crashed and hit us. In that situation, you are just a passenger, there's nothing you can do. Unfortunately, that hit was too much for our car. From the cockpit you don't understand how much damage there is, but the car didn't feel great, it had a lot of oversteer so I asked the team what was the damage but they were not completely sure because they'd lost the telemetry. At the end, we had some electrical problems and we had to stop."

    He had been doing an outstanding job all weekend IMO. Shame that.
